Traitement au durvalumab en association avec la chimiothérapie et le bevacizumab, suivi d'un traitement d'entretien au durvalumab, au bevacizumab et à l'olaparib chez les patientes atteintes d'un cancer de l'ovaire avancé (DUO-O)
Une étude multicentrique de phase III randomisée, en double aveugle, contrôlée par placebo sur le durvalumab en association avec la chimiothérapie et le bevacizumab, suivie d'un traitement d'entretien par le durvalumab, le bevacizumab et l'olaparib chez des patientes nouvellement diagnostiquées d'un cancer de l'ovaire avancé (DUO-O).

Description détaillée
Les patientes éligibles seront les patientes atteintes d'un cancer de l'ovaire, du péritoine primitif et/ou des trompes de Fallope nouvellement diagnostiqué et histologiquement confirmé (Fédération Internationale de Gynécologie et d'Obstétrique [FIGO] Stade III-IV). Tous les patients doivent être candidats à une chirurgie de cytoréduction qui pourrait être réalisée comme une chirurgie primaire immédiate après le diagnostic ou peut être réalisée après le début d'une chimiothérapie néoadjuvante à base de platine. Tous les patients doivent être éligibles pour commencer une chimiothérapie de première intention à base de platine en association avec le bevacizumab.
L'étude vise à évaluer l'efficacité et l'innocuité de la chimiothérapie standard à base de platine (SoC) et du bevacizumab suivis du bevacizumab d'entretien soit en monothérapie, soit en association avec le durvalumab, soit en association avec le durvalumab et l'olaparib. Par conséquent, cette étude vise à voir quelle combinaison permet aux patients de vivre plus longtemps sans que le cancer ne réapparaisse ou ne s'aggrave. L'étude cherche également à voir quelle combinaison permet aux patients de vivre plus longtemps et comment le traitement et le cancer affectent leur qualité de vie.

Critères d'inclusion clés :
Patientes atteintes d'un cancer épithélial de l'ovaire de haut grade nouvellement diagnostiqué, histologiquement confirmé, avancé (stade III-IV), y compris un cancer de l'ovaire à cellules claires de haut grade, un cancer de l'ovaire à cellules claires ou un carcinosarcome, un cancer péritonéal primitif et/ou un cancer des trompes de Fallope
- Les patients doivent être âgés de ≥ 18 ans. Pour les patients inscrits au Japon qui sont âgés
- Tous les patients doivent être candidats à une chirurgie de cytoréduction soit : chirurgie primaire initiale OU prévoir de subir une chimiothérapie avec une chirurgie de réduction volumineuse à intervalles
- Preuve de présence ou d'absence de mutation BRCA1/2 dans le tissu tumoral
- Fourniture obligatoire d'un échantillon de tumeur pour le test tBRCA centralisé
- Statut de performance ECOG 0-1
- Les patients doivent avoir une fonction préservée des organes et de la moelle osseuse
- Postménopause ou preuve d'absence de procréation pour les femmes en âge de procréer : test de grossesse urinaire ou sérique négatif
Critères d'exclusion clés :
Cancer de l'ovaire non épithélial, tumeurs borderline, tumeurs épithéliales de bas grade ou histologie mucineuse
- Traitement anticancéreux systémique antérieur pour le cancer de l'ovaire
- Incapacité à déterminer la présence ou l'absence d'une mutation BRCA délétère ou suspectée d'être délétère
- Traitement antérieur avec un inhibiteur de PARP ou une thérapie à médiation immunitaire
- Chimiothérapie cytotoxique intrapéritonéale programmée
- Troubles auto-immuns ou inflammatoires actifs ou antérieurs documentés
- Patients considérés comme à faible risque médical en raison d'une maladie intercurrente grave et non maîtrisée
- Maladie cardiovasculaire cliniquement significative
- Patients présentant des métastases cérébrales connues
Antécédents d'une autre tumeur maligne primitive à l'exception de :
- Malignité traitée avec une intention curative et sans maladie active connue ≥ 5 ans avant la première dose du traitement à l'étude et à faible risque potentiel de récidive (les patientes ayant déjà reçu une chimiothérapie adjuvante pour un cancer du sein à un stade précoce peuvent être éligibles, à condition qu'elle ait été complétée ≥ 3 ans avant l'enregistrement, et que le patient reste exempt de maladie récurrente ou métastatique)
- Cancer de la peau non mélanome ou lentigo maligna traité de manière adéquate sans signe de maladie
- Carcinome in situ traité de manière adéquate sans signe de maladie
- Cancer de l'endomètre Stade IA FIGO, Grade 1 ou Grade 2
- Toxicités persistantes CTCAE Grade> 2 causées par un traitement anticancéreux antérieur
- Patients présentant une hypersensibilité connue à l'olaparib, au durvalumab ou à l'un des excipients de ces produits et à l'association/comparateurs
- Femmes qui allaitent

Comparateur actif: Bras 1
Chimiothérapie à base de platine en association avec le bevacizumab et le placebo de durvalumab (perfusion IV saline) suivie d'un traitement d'entretien par le bevacizumab, le placebo de durvalumab (perfusion IV saline) et le placebo d'olaparib (comprimés).
|
Bevacizumab par perfusion intraveineuse.
Dans la cohorte tBRCAm, le bevacizumab est facultatif selon la pratique locale.
Comprimés placebo pour correspondre à l'olaparib
Placebo correspondant pour perfusion intraveineuse
Chimiothérapie de référence
|
|
Expérimental: Bras 2
Chimiothérapie à base de platine en association avec le bevacizumab et le durvalumab suivie d'un traitement d'entretien par le bevacizumab, le durvalumab et un placebo d'olaparib.
|
Bevacizumab par perfusion intraveineuse.
Dans la cohorte tBRCAm, le bevacizumab est facultatif selon la pratique locale.
Comprimés placebo pour correspondre à l'olaparib
Chimiothérapie de référence
Durvalumab en perfusion intraveineuse
|
|
Expérimental: Bras 3
Chimiothérapie à base de platine en association avec le bevacizumab et le durvalumab suivie d'un traitement d'entretien par le bevacizumab, le durvalumab et l'olaparib.
|
Comprimés d'olaparib
Bevacizumab par perfusion intraveineuse.
Dans la cohorte tBRCAm, le bevacizumab est facultatif selon la pratique locale.
Chimiothérapie de référence
Durvalumab en perfusion intraveineuse
|
|
Expérimental: Cohorte tBRCAm
Chimiothérapie à base de platine en association avec le bevacizumab et le durvalumab suivie d'un traitement d'entretien par le bevacizumab, le durvalumab et l'olaparib.
Le bevacizumab est facultatif selon la pratique locale.
|
Comprimés d'olaparib
Bevacizumab par perfusion intraveineuse.
Dans la cohorte tBRCAm, le bevacizumab est facultatif selon la pratique locale.
Chimiothérapie de référence
Durvalumab en perfusion intraveineuse

Que mesure l'étude ?
Principaux critères de jugement
Mesure des résultats |
Description de la mesure |
Délai |
|---|---|---|
|
Progression-free Survival (PFS) by Investigator Assessment Using Modified RECIST 1.1 - Full Analysis Set
Délai: At baseline, within 3 weeks of last dose of chemotherapy, then every 12 weeks for 3 years and thereafter every 24 weeks. Assessed until primary analysis - (05DEC2022 for Global cohort, 17MAR2025 for China cohort) - upto 46 months
|
To determine the efficacy of durvalumab in combination with platinum based chemotherapy and bevacizumab and continued as maintenance in combination with bevacizumab and olaparib versus SoC platinum based chemotherapy in combination with bevacizumab by assessment of PFS (using investigator assessment according to Response Evaluation Criteria in Solid Tumours version 1.1 [RECIST 1.1]) in the first line treatment of patients with newly diagnosed advanced ovarian cancer. Per MTP, the comparison of SoC+D+O v SoC in the Non-tbRCAm patients is a primary endpoint. SoC+D v SoC is reported separately as a secondary endpoint. Results for tBRCAm SoC+D+O are not presented as this was prespecified to be assessed only in the Non-tBRCAm patients. |
At baseline, within 3 weeks of last dose of chemotherapy, then every 12 weeks for 3 years and thereafter every 24 weeks. Assessed until primary analysis - (05DEC2022 for Global cohort, 17MAR2025 for China cohort) - upto 46 months
|
|
Progression-free Survival (PFS) by Investigator Assessment Using Modified RECIST 1.1 - (Full Analysis Set, HRD Positive)
Délai: At baseline, within 3 weeks of last dose of chemotherapy, then every 12 weeks for 3 years and thereafter every 24 weeks. Assessed until DCO1 - (05DEC2022 for Global cohort, 17MAR2025 for China cohort) - upto 46 months
|
To determine the efficacy of durvalumab and olaparib assessed by PFS in the first line treatment of patients with newly diagnosed advanced ovarian cancer. Per MTP, the comparison of SoC+D+O v SoC in the Non-tBRCAm HRD positve population is a primary endpoint. SoC+D v SoC is reported separately as a secondary endpoint. Results for tBRCAm SoC+D+O are not presented as as this was prespecified to be assessed only in the Non-tBRCAm patients. |
At baseline, within 3 weeks of last dose of chemotherapy, then every 12 weeks for 3 years and thereafter every 24 weeks. Assessed until DCO1 - (05DEC2022 for Global cohort, 17MAR2025 for China cohort) - upto 46 months
